❦ Artist and Muse Digital Illustration & Mixed-Media Collage Luna J. Yvelisse, 2025Artist & Muse is a self-portrait. As the artist, the subject, & the muse, I reject the historical tradition of women existing solely as objects of admiration. We are creators, storytellers, & subjects. Through this work, I invite viewers to examine femininity through the lens of bodily autonomy & the contradictions imposed upon women. Society celebrates women in theory—as mothers, muses, lovers, goddesses, & caretakers yet often values us according to beauty standards, respectability politics, reproductive capacity, desirability, & the labor our bodies, minds, & spirits can produce. We are praised when we are useful, disciplined when we are autonomous, & condemned when we refuse to be possessed. Rather than separating beauty from intellect or sensuality from spirituality, Artist & Muse rejects those false binaries. It reclaims adornment, desire, softness, rage, & self-representation as expressions of agency rather than vanity. My body becomes an altar not an object of consumption, but a site of creativity, healing, devotion, & power. Built as a devotional collage, what you witness defines my visual language & personal world: paintbrushes, pigments, tropical flora, shells, crystals, sacred objects, celestial imagery, & references to Afro-Indigenous Caribbean spirituality & Espiritismo. These recurring symbols represent the things I love & the worlds that have shaped me, woven together into a personal archive of identity, ancestry, memory, & creation.
